Ferguson takes Ronaldo move in his stride.
Manchester United manager Sir Alex Ferguson says he was resigned to seeing Cristiano Ronaldo leave Old Trafford.
The 24-year-old Portuguese winger is poised to complete a record £80m move to Real Madrid, with reports suggesting the deal has long been in place.
And Ferguson, who is on holiday in the south of France, told the Mail on Sunday: “He wanted to leave, it is as simple as that.
“He was going to go some time. We’ve done well to keep him for so long.” (BBC Sport)
